The Influence of Media and Public Perception
The media plays a pivotal role in shaping public perception, often turning legal proceedings into public spectacles. With the rise of social media, the instant dissemination of information can impact jury selection and trial outcomes. For instance, the Derek Chauvin trial highlighted the power of video evidence in swaying public opinion and judicial processes.
Strategies in Legal Defense and Prosecution
Defense and prosecution strategies are continually evolving. In high-stakes cases, employing a “shock and awe” strategy, as seen in Combs’ trial, can dismantle initial positive perceptions and focus jurors’ attention on alleged misconduct. Such strategies leverage graphic evidence to establish an immediate narrative and maintain its grip on the jury.
Role of Technology in Trials
Technology, particularly video surveillance and digital records, has become central to modern trials. The immutable nature of digital evidence makes it a powerful tool in court, often taking precedence over verbal testimonies. Defense teams are adapting by increasing their reliance on expert witnesses who can interpret and counteract technological evidence.
Impact on Victims and Witnesses
The psychological impact on victims and witnesses in celebrity trials is immense. High stakes create additional stress, impacting their testimony and overall well-being. Legal systems are increasingly recognizing the need for better support structures to help victims navigate these challenging experiences.
Evolution of Jury Dynamics
Jury dynamics are shifting with increased awareness of biases, especially in cases involving celebrities. Selecting an impartial jury that can view cases objectively, despite preconceived notions about the defendant, is becoming more complex.
